EDITORS COMMENTS
This print from Memory Lane Prints takes us back to a significant moment in history - October 1919, during the Railway strike. The image features none other than Winston Churchill himself, standing resolute outside number 11 Downing Street. Dressed impeccably in his signature top hat and holding a cane, Churchill exudes an air of authority and determination. As we gaze at this snapshot frozen in time, we can almost feel the tension that must have filled the air during those tumultuous days. A police officer stands nearby, a symbol of order amidst chaos. The grandeur of number 11 Downing Street serves as a backdrop to this historic scene. Churchill's presence here is no coincidence; he was known for his strong leadership and unwavering resolve during times of crisis. This photograph captures him at one such pivotal moment when the railway workers' strike threatened to paralyze the nation's transportation system.
